Pill Effectiveness and Safety

I've been researching the effectiveness and safety of traditional sleeping pills and how they work. Here's what I've found:

  • Pill effectiveness: Traditional sleeping pills, such as benzodiazepines and non-benzodiazepines, can be effective in promoting sleep by enhancing the effects of GABA, a neurotransmitter that helps regulate sleep. These pills can help you fall asleep faster, stay asleep longer, and improve sleep quality.
  • Pill safety: While traditional sleeping pills can be effective, they also come with potential risks and side effects. Common side effects include dizziness, drowsiness, and cognitive impairment. Long-term use may lead to dependence or tolerance, and some studies have associated their use with an increased risk of accidents and falls, especially in older adults.
  • Individual variability: The effectiveness and safety of sleeping pills can vary from person to person. Factors such as age, overall health, and other medications being taken can influence their efficacy and potential side effects.
  • Consultation with a healthcare provider: It's important to consult with a healthcare provider before starting any sleep medication to determine its suitability for your specific situation and to discuss potential risks and benefits.

Traditional Pill Risks

There are several potential side effects associated with taking traditional sleeping pills. These pills, while effective in promoting sleep, come with their fair share of risks. Here are some of the dangers associated with traditional pills:

  • Dependency: Traditional sleeping pills can be addictive, leading to dependence on the medication for sleep.
  • Daytime drowsiness: Many individuals experience grogginess and drowsiness the next day after taking sleeping pills, making it difficult to function optimally.
  • Memory and cognitive impairments: Research has shown that traditional sleeping pills may affect memory and cognitive function, leading to difficulties in concentration and learning.
  • Increased risk of falls and accidents: The sedative effects of sleeping pills can increase the risk of falls and accidents, especially in older adults.

Safer Sleep Alternatives:

  • Herbal supplements such as valerian root and chamomile have been used for centuries to promote relaxation and improve sleep quality.
  • Cognitive behavioral therapy for insomnia (CBT-I) is a non-pharmacological approach that focuses on changing behaviors and thoughts that contribute to poor sleep.
  • Relaxation techniques like yoga, meditation, and deep breathing exercises can help calm the mind and prepare the body for a restful sleep.
  • Creating a conducive sleep environment by maintaining a regular sleep schedule, avoiding electronic devices before bed, and ensuring a comfortable mattress and pillow.

CBD Oil: An Overview

After researching the benefits of CBD oil, I am convinced that it is a promising natural sleep aid. CBD oil, also known as cannabidiol, is a compound derived from the hemp plant. It has gained popularity in recent years for its potential therapeutic effects. Numerous studies have been conducted to explore the potential benefits of CBD oil for sleep.

One of the key benefits of CBD oil is its ability to promote relaxation and reduce anxiety, which are common factors that can interfere with sleep. Research suggests that CBD oil may help to alleviate symptoms of anxiety and improve sleep quality. A study published in The Permanente Journal found that participants with anxiety and sleep problems experienced significant improvements in both conditions after taking CBD oil.

CBD oil has also been found to have anti-inflammatory properties, which may be beneficial for individuals suffering from chronic pain or conditions such as arthritis. Chronic pain can often disrupt sleep patterns, and CBD oil may help to alleviate pain and improve sleep quality.
